Today we’re talking about generosity. Part of our mission as a firm is to become more generous and to develop a culture of generosity with our clients. What does that actually mean though, and why would we do that?
- It turns out that being generous is really beneficial not only for the recipient, but also for the giver.
- In a recent study linked below, people were asked about how generous they were, how likely they were to donate, to voluntarily do something for someone else, to give directions to a stranger, and high-generosity respondents were more than twice as likely to be "very satisfied" with their life over the past year.
